Remember, the In-Depth Discussion forum is to be used for discussing puzzles, assignments, clues, and questions about a video series. Properly naming threads is very important to ensuring that people can find them and contribute in the right place.
To name new threads, please use the following style:
series name - [type of discussion (in brackets)] - your title/question
For example:
HSA - [assignment] Due date?
Facility J - [puzzle] New interpretations
itscassie - [question] What does the sign language mean?
Sister - [SOLVED] To OpAphid
Please note that a moderator may rename a thread or ask that you do so if improperly named. Note also that not all old threads will be renamed according to this style (due to all of our time constraints)
